About Nyona
Nyona is a captivating name with African origins. It's a versatile choice, suitable for both girls and boys. One interpretation connects Nyona to the Yoruba language, where it signifies a brave and fearless individual. This meaning speaks to strength and resilience, making it a powerful choice for parents seeking a name that embodies courage. Another source points to Bantu origins, linking Nyona to the meaning of "bird". This association evokes imagery of freedom and grace.
